Noise Compensation Technology: If your vehicle has
the Radio with DVD Audio, HDD, and USB, it includes
Bose AudioPilot
®
noise compensation technology.
When turned on, AudioPilot
®
continuously adjusts the
audio system equalization, to compensate for
background noise.
This feature is most effective at lower radio volume
settings where background noise can affect how well
you hear the music being played through your vehicle’s
audio system. At higher volume settings, where the
music is much louder than the background noise,
there might be little or no adjustments by AudioPilot
®
.
For additional information on AudioPilot
®
, visit
www.bose.com/audiopilot.
To activate AudioPilot
®
:
1. Press the CONFIG button to display the radio
setup menu.
2. Press the pushbutton under the AUTO VOL label
on the radio display.
3. Press either the On or Off label located under the
AUTO VOL display to turn this feature on or off. The
display times out after approximately 10 seconds.
Finding a Station
TUNE/TONE: Turn to select different radio stations
within a selected band.
FM/AM: Press to switch between FM and AM
radio bands.
©SEEK ¨: Press the arrows to go to the previous
or to the next radio station and stay there.
The radio only tunes into stations with a strong signal
that are in the selected band.
INFO (Information) (FM-RDS, XM™ Satellite Radio
Service, CD-Text, CD Gracenote Database, HDD,
MP3/WMA, and iPod): Press to display additional text
information related to the currently playing content.
When information is not available, No Information
displays.
MENU/SELECT: For FM/AM stations, the
MENU/SELECT displays a list of available radio
stations. Under this menu, there is a refresh list selection
that allows the user to update the list for all available
stations that the radio is able to receive at the current
location.
